Learn more about Mongu

Paddle through the Zambezi floodplains on a traditional mokoro canoe while spotting colourful birds and local fishermen at work. Discover authentic Lozi culture at Nayuma Museum and browse handcrafted baskets, textiles, and wood carvings at Mumwa Craft Association.

Things to do in Mongu

Shopping

In Mongu, explore local markets for unique crafts and souvenirs, offering a glimpse into Zambian culture. If you're up for a drive, visit the Mongu Shopping Mall, around 19km away, which features a selection of shops and eateries for a more extensive shopping experience.

Recreation

In Mongu, the Zambezi River offers serene boat cruises, allowing you to connect with nature while enjoying the tranquil waters. Nearby, wellness retreats provide traditional healing therapies and yoga sessions, encouraging relaxation and mindfulness amidst the beautiful landscapes of Western Province.

Adventure

Explore the beautiful Liuwa Plain National Park, known for its stunning landscapes and wildlife. Engage in game drives to observe the diverse fauna, including the wild dog population. Experience traditional fishing along the Zambezi River, immersing yourself in local culture and breathtaking scenery.

Nightlife

The nightlife in Mongu offers a blend of local culture and laid-back vibes. For a lively evening, visit the bustling bars along the main street, where you can enjoy traditional Zambian music and dance. Alternatively, relax at a local café for a quieter atmosphere with friendly conversation.

Best time to go to Mongu

The best time to visit Mongu is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. October is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is sunny with no r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January73.4°F (23.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ageModerately High
February73.6°F (23.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ighModerately Low
April73.0°F (22.8°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May70.5°F (21.4°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June66.4°F (19.1°C)No RainSunnyAverageModerately Low
July66.0°F (18.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
August72.1°F (22.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owModerately Low
September79.5°F (26.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
October82.9°F (28.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owModerately High
November78.6°F (25.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December75.0°F (23.9°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owModerately High

What's the weather like in Mongu?
The hottest months are usually October and September, with an average temperature of 26°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 20°C. The rainiest months in Mongu are January, December,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 258 mm of rainfall.
